What Are Drone Analytics Tools?

At the core, drone analytics tools are advanced software platforms that process, analyze, and interpret visual data collected by drones. The complex aerial imagery and raw sensor readings from the drones make little sense until they pass through an artificial intelligence-powered algorithm and are converted into meaningful business intelligence.

Core Capabilities of Modern UAV Analytics Platforms

Most modern UAV analytics platforms are capable of processing data, using AI-powered analytics, and ensuring secure and comprehensive data collection, among others. These platforms need to be user-friendly and must communicate with several devices simultaneously.

However, talking about the core suite of functions, they should be able to:

  • Automate data processing and classifications
  • Perform Geospatial data analysis and mapping
  • Execute change detection and temporal analysis
  • Conduct measurement and volumetric calculations
  • Generate detailed reports and visualisations (drone data visualisation)
  • Provide integration capabilities with other business systems (drone data integration
  • Utilise AI-powered object recognition and anomaly detection

Types of data processed

Modern drone data analytics solutions can easily process various types of data. Some of these are:

  • High-resolution visual imagery: RGB data captured while performing tasks like mapping, inspection, and progress tracking
  • Thermal imaging: Monitoring heat signatures for specific tasks. While heat signatures are tracked to help survivors in search and rescue operations, monitoring heat loss in solar panel analysis has a different use case.
  • Multispectral/Hyperspectral: Processing multispectral data is critically important for agriculture and helps assess vegetation health and growth. Hyperspectral data is used for environmental monitoring and detailed surface composition analysis.
  • LiDAR: Crucial for drone surveying tools, LiDAR data helps in creating 3D models of terrains and detailed site modelling.

Top Use Cases of Drone Analytics Software Tools

Aerial data analytics find utility in several sectors:

Agriculture: Aerial imagery analysis is crucial to determine the crop’s health, timely detection of pest infection or diseases, and optimise irrigation. Precision agriculture relies heavily on UAV analytics for proactive intervention to improve vegetation health by detecting stress levels and accurately estimating yields.

Construction & Infrastructure:Construction companies rely on drone analytics for site inspection and progress tracking. Drone mapping software creates accurate site models, tracks progress, and identifies potential issues.

Drone inspection software coupled with analytics is ideal for rapid site surveys, volumetric calculations for earthworks, and automated inspections of bridges, buildings, power lines, etc.

Security & Surveillance:Real-time drone data analytics are important in offering actionable insights during operations, enabling perimeter monitoring, crowd analysis, anomaly detection, and enhanced situational awareness.

Environmental Monitoring: Environmental agencies apply remote sensing data processing techniques to monitor ecosystem changes and disaster impacts and track wildlife populations.

Benefits of Using Drone Analytics Tools

Integrating drone data management and analytics strategy into your workflow can help you enhance processes, save time, and make more informed decisions. Some of its several benefits are highlighted below:

Time Efficiency and Accuracy:One of the biggest benefits of drone analytics software is its ability to expedite data collection and analysis. It can reduce the time spent manually reviewing tons of visual data and data points.

Moreover, leveraging machine learning for drone data algorithms can enhance accuracy and efficiency compared to traditional methods.

Enhanced Decision-Making:Clear communication and easy access to updated data help improve coordination between various stakeholders and enable well-informed decisions.

Cost-Effectiveness Over Traditional Methods:Monitoring and surveillance using drones is instant and devoid of logistical hassles. It also requires less manpower but may offer better data than traditional methods like helicopters.
